Abortion Activists Who Terrorized Pro-Lifers Get Community Service

Pro-abortion activists who were arrested after terrorizing attendees and speakers at a pro-life event will not face jail time or have a criminal record but will have to perform community service. Students for Life president Kristan Hawkins and Turning Point USA contributor Isabel Brown were at Virginia Commonwealth University (VCU) on a scheduled stop of the organization’s “Lies Pro-Choicers Believe” tour. Hawkins kept her camera rolling on Instagram Live as protests broke out and pro-abortion activists chanted, “F**k Pro-lifers” and “Fascists Go Home.” SFLA said the protestors used their signs to physically assault individuals who were present. Appeals Court Blocks Biden's Emergency Abortion Guidelines

The anti-abortion physicians group that sued the Biden administration over abortion restrictions in Texas praised a ruling from the United States Court of Appeals for the 5th Circuit that found that federal regulations do not grant an absolute right to abortion. In July 2022, the Biden administration issued new guidance interpreting the Emergency Medical Treatment and Labor Act, or EMTALA, to allow for induced abortions to stabilize a patient when necessary in an emergency situation regardless of state law banning elective abortions. Two-Thirds of Americans Support Some Abortion Restrictions

About two-thirds of Americans support some level of government restrictions on abortion, according to a recent poll released by the Knights of Columbus. The poll, which the Knights conducted with Marist Institute for Public Opinion at Marist College, found that 66% of Americans believe that "limits should be placed on when abortion is allowed" and only 33% believe that "abortion should be allowed without any limits" when given the two options.
